VMProtect Professional v3.8.1 Build 1695 is a specialized software protection solution designed to help developers shield their applications from reverse engineering, cracking, and unauthorized analysis. By using a "virtual machine" architecture, it transforms executable code into a unique bytecode format that can only be executed by a custom-generated virtual interpreter. Key Features of VMProtect Professional Code Virtualization

: Converts sensitive parts of your code into a non-standard instruction set, making it extremely difficult for crackers to understand the original logic. Mutation and Obfuscation

: Adds "junk" code and alters the structure of the executable to confuse disassemblers and debuggers. Anti-Debugging & Anti-Analysis

: Includes built-in checks to detect if the software is running under a debugger or within a virtual environment. License Management

: Provides tools to create serial numbers, set expiration dates, and lock software to specific hardware. Format Support vmprotectprofessionalv381build1695softor link

: Compatible with a wide range of formats, including executable files (EXE, SCR), dynamic-link libraries (DLL, OCX), and drivers (SYS). Why Developers Use Build 1695 Build 1695

Diving into VMProtect Professional v3.8.1 Build 1695 VMProtect is a powerful, Russian-made security utility designed to protect software from reverse engineering by running its code on a unique, non-standard virtual machine. While the official latest version is currently 3.10.4 as of March 2026, version v3.8.1 Build 1695 gained significant attention in early 2023 due to it appearing on various technical and security forums like Kanxue. Virtual Machine Language: Like all versions of VMProtect, it converts executable code into a custom bytecode that is nearly impossible for standard decompilers to read.

Mutation Engine: It uses an advanced obfuscation engine to add "garbage" commands and "dead" code to binaries, further confusing anyone attempting to crack the software.

Licensing System: This version includes the integrated RSA-based licensing system, which handles serial number generation and expiration without needing external tools. Safety and Legal Warnings

1. The "Hollow Crack" Malware Attack

Security researchers have analyzed "cracks" for VMProtect 3.x. Many contain hollow process injection. The crack appears to run, but in the background, it injects a Remote Access Trojan (RAT) into a legitimate Windows process (e.g., svchost.exe). This gives the attacker full control over your development PC.
